Emotion-Related Information
Data or stimuli that are specifically related to feelings or affective states, which can influence perception, decision-making, and behavior.
Polygraph Tests
A forensic tool designed to detect physiological signs of lying or truthfulness through measures of bodily responses.
Electrical Resistance
A measure of the difficulty encountered by an electric current as it flows through a conductor.
Heart Rate
The number of heartbeats per minute, a vital sign that can indicate physical health and fitness levels.
